The Origin of the Term

The word Renaissance refers to the cultural rebirth that swept across Europe between the 14th and 17th centuries. Also, during this period, scholars revived classical learning and broke away from medieval constraints, giving rise to a generation of “universal men” who pursued mastery in multiple arenas. In practice, leonardo da Vinci, perhaps the archetype, was a painter, engineer, anatomist, and inventor—all at once. The notion of a Renaissance man therefore encapsulated the belief that human potential is not limited to a single vocation Still holds up..

Translating the Concept to the 21st Century

Fast forward five centuries, and the world has become more complex, interconnected, and technologically driven. While the sheer volume of knowledge has exploded, the need for individuals who can synthesize information across domains has grown even stronger. A modern Renaissance man does not merely collect facts; he integrates them, turning disparate insights into novel solutions. He may be a software developer who also writes poetry, a physician who designs sustainable architecture, or an entrepreneur who mentors youth in robotics while studying philosophy.

Core Characteristics

  1. Curiosity‑driven Learning – An insatiable desire to understand how things work, not just what they are.
  2. Cross‑disciplinary Fluency – Ability to speak the language of multiple fields, enabling collaboration.
  3. Creative Problem‑Solving – Applying techniques from one discipline to challenges in another.
  4. Lifelong Commitment – Continuous skill‑building beyond formal education.

These traits distinguish a modern Renaissance man from a jack‑of‑all‑trades who lacks depth. The modern polymath balances breadth with depth, ensuring each new competence is anchored in solid fundamentals Still holds up..


Step‑by‑Step or Concept Breakdown

Step 1: Identify Your Core Passion

Begin with a subject that excites you enough to sustain long‑term study—be it coding, music, biology, or philosophy. This becomes your anchor.

  • Why it matters: A strong anchor prevents the drift into superficial learning and provides a platform for interdisciplinary expansion.

Step 2: Map Complementary Disciplines

Create a visual map linking your core passion to adjacent fields. For a data scientist, adjacent areas could include psychology (understanding user behavior), ethics (AI bias), and design (visual storytelling).

  • Tool tip: Use mind‑mapping software or a simple notebook to sketch connections.

Step 3: Adopt a Structured Learning Routine

Allocate dedicated time blocks for each discipline. The 70‑20‑10 rule (70 % practice, 20 % mentorship, 10 % formal study) works well for mastering multiple skills Small thing, real impact..

  • Practice: Build a project that forces you to apply two fields simultaneously (e.g., a mobile app that visualizes ecological data).
  • Mentorship: Join communities—online forums, local meetups, or university clubs—where experts can guide you.

Step 4: Synthesize Through Projects

Real learning occurs when you produce something that merges your skill set. Projects act as proof of concept and portfolio pieces.

  • Example: Write a short story that incorporates quantum physics concepts, then illustrate it using digital art tools.

Step 5: Reflect and Iterate

Every quarter, assess what you’ve learned, where gaps remain, and how your interdisciplinary work has impacted your primary field. Adjust your roadmap accordingly.

  • Reflection journal: Document breakthroughs, frustrations, and insights about how different domains inform each other.

2. Maya Angelou – Poetry, Civil Rights Activism, and Culinary Arts

Maya Angelou was not only a celebrated poet and memoirist but also a civil‑rights activist, a journalist, and a restaurateur. Her diverse experiences enriched her literary voice, allowing her to capture the human condition from multiple perspectives.

3. Dr. Mae Jemison – Medicine, Engineering, and Space Exploration

Mae Jemison earned a medical degree, studied chemical engineering, and became the first African‑American woman astronaut. After NASA, she founded a technology company and teaches interdisciplinary design, embodying the modern polymath’s commitment to lifelong learning and societal impact.

Common Mistakes or Misunderstandings

  1. Mistaking Breadth for Superficiality
    Many assume that dabbling in many subjects equals being a Renaissance man. In reality, without depth, knowledge remains fragmented and ineffective. The key is to achieve functional expertise in each area—enough to contribute meaningfully.

  2. Neglecting Mastery of the Core Discipline
    Some polymaths abandon their original passion in pursuit of novelty, leading to a loss of identity and credibility. Maintaining a strong anchor prevents this drift That's the part that actually makes a difference..

  3. Overloading Without Prioritization
    Trying to learn five new skills simultaneously can cause burnout. Prioritize based on relevance to your goals, and adopt a staggered approach.

  4. Ignoring the Importance of Community
    Polymathy is not a solitary quest. Failing to seek mentors, peer feedback, or collaborative projects limits growth and reduces the richness of interdisciplinary insight.


FAQs

Q1: Can anyone become a modern Renaissance man, or is it an innate talent?
A: While some individuals display natural curiosity, the Renaissance mindset is largely skill‑based. It requires deliberate practice, structured learning, and a willingness to step outside comfort zones. Anyone with commitment can develop polymathic abilities.

Q2: How much time should I allocate each week to develop multiple skills?
A: A practical starting point is 10‑15 hours per week, divided into focused blocks (e.g., 3 hours coding, 2 hours music, 2 hours reading philosophy). Adjust based on progress and personal capacity, ensuring rest to avoid cognitive fatigue.

Q3: Does being a Renaissance man mean I must excel equally in all fields?
A: Not necessarily. The goal is competence and interoperability, not identical mastery. You may be a world‑class violinist and a competent data analyst; the combination still yields powerful interdisciplinary insights.

Q4: How does a modern Renaissance man stay relevant in rapidly changing industries?
A: By continual learning and adaptability. Embrace emerging technologies (e.g., AI, quantum computing) and integrate them into existing skill sets. Regularly reassess your knowledge map to incorporate new disciplines that complement your core expertise.

Q5: Are there formal certifications or degrees for becoming a polymath?
A: No single credential exists. Still, interdisciplinary programs (e.g., liberal arts, STEAM degrees) and micro‑credential platforms (Coursera, edX) provide modular learning pathways that support a polymathic education The details matter here..
